This lets the Cynus T1's fuel gauge IC map its coulomb counter against the new cell's actual discharge curve before high-current charging begins on an uncalibrated cell.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n  \u003chr class=\"bpw-desc-divider\"\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003eSudden shutdown at 20–30% on the Cynus T1 after a cell swap\u003c\/h3\u003e\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eThis happens when the fuel gauge IC is still calibrated to the old cell's discharge curve. The new cell hits a voltage cliff under modem or display load that the gauge didn't predict, so the phone shuts down before the reported percentage reaches zero. It is not a defective battery. Run one full discharge to automatic shutdown, then charge uninterrupted to 100% — the fuel gauge IC recalibrates against the new cell during that cycle and the premature cutoff stops.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003ePhone won't power on after the BTY26179 sat in storage\u003c\/h3\u003e\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eLi-ion cells in storage self-discharge slowly. If the cell drops below approximately 2.5V, the BMS enters lockout to prevent damage to the cell chemistry. The Cynus T1 will show nothing on screen — no charging animation, no boot logo. Connect the phone to a wall charger rated at 5V\/1A and leave it for 20–30 minutes without pressing any buttons. Once the BMS sees enough voltage to exit lockout, the charging indicator will appear and the phone will boot normally.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"BatteryWeb","offers":[{"title":"Warranty 1 Year","offer_id":43404327714906,"sku":"BWCS-MCT100SL-1","price":23.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 2 Year","offer_id":43404327747674,"sku":"BWCS-MCT100SL-2","price":26.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 3 Year","offer_id":43404327780442,"sku":"BWCS-MCT100SL-3","price":29.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0674\/4775\/0746\/files\/BW-CS-MCT100SL-1.webp?v=1779369761","url":"https:\/\/batteryweb.com\/products\/mobistel-cynus-t1-replacement-battery-37v-1980mah-li-ion","provider":"BatteryWeb","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
